AOne极速部署DeepSeek:24小时全员上线的技术密码
2025.09.19 17:26浏览量:0简介:本文揭秘AOne团队如何在24小时内完成DeepSeek企业级部署,从架构设计、自动化工具链到安全合规策略,系统阐述快速落地的技术实现路径与实战经验。
引言:企业AI部署的”不可能三角”
在企业AI落地过程中,技术团队常面临效率、成本与安全的三重矛盾:既要快速上线满足业务需求,又要控制技术债务与资源消耗,还需符合行业合规标准。AOne团队仅用22小时便完成DeepSeek从环境搭建到全员推广的全流程,这一案例打破了传统AI部署的”月级”周期认知,其技术实现路径值得深入剖析。
一、模块化架构设计:解耦与复用的艺术
1.1 容器化基础设施
AOne采用Kubernetes+Docker的标准化容器方案,将DeepSeek核心服务拆分为:
# deployment.yaml 示例
apiVersion: apps/v1
kind: Deployment
metadata:
name: deepseek-core
spec:
replicas: 3
selector:
matchLabels:
app: deepseek
template:
spec:
containers:
- name: model-server
image: deepseek/model-server:v1.2
resources:
limits:
nvidia.com/gpu: 1
通过容器镜像的版本管理,实现计算资源与模型服务的解耦,支持横向扩展与故障自愈。
1.2 微服务化接口层
将用户认证、模型调用、日志审计等功能封装为独立服务:
# auth_service.py 示例
from fastapi import FastAPI, Depends
from jose import JWTError
app = FastAPI()
@app.post("/authenticate")
async def authenticate(token: str):
try:
payload = jwt.decode(token, SECRET_KEY, algorithms=["HS256"])
return {"user_id": payload["sub"], "permissions": payload["perm"]}
except JWTError:
raise HTTPException(status_code=401, detail="Invalid token")
这种设计使权限系统与模型服务完全隔离,为后续安全策略实施奠定基础。
二、自动化工具链:从CI/CD到智能运维
2.1 持续集成流水线
构建包含模型验证、压力测试、回滚机制的CI流程:
// Jenkinsfile 示例
pipeline {
agent any
stages {
stage('Model Validation') {
steps {
sh 'python validate_model.py --input test_data.json'
}
}
stage('Load Testing') {
steps {
sh 'locust -f load_test.py --host=https://deepseek.example.com'
}
}
}
}
通过自动化测试将部署风险前置,确保每次迭代的质量可控。
2.2 智能运维系统
部署基于Prometheus+Grafana的监控体系,关键指标包括:
- 模型推理延迟(P99 < 500ms)
- GPU利用率(目标值70-85%)
- 接口错误率(<0.1%)
设置动态阈值告警,当QPS突增时自动触发扩容脚本:
#!/bin/bash
CURRENT_LOAD=$(kubectl get hpa deepseek -o jsonpath='{.status.currentMetrics[0].resource.current}' | cut -d '/' -f1)
if (( $(echo "$CURRENT_LOAD > 80" | bc -l) )); then
kubectl scale deployment deepseek-core --replicas=$((REPLICAS+2))
fi
三、渐进式推广策略:从试点到全员
3.1 灰度发布机制
采用Nginx流量分片实现渐进式上线:
# nginx.conf 示例
upstream deepseek {
server v1.deepseek.example.com weight=90;
server v2.deepseek.example.com weight=10;
}
首日仅开放10%流量至新版本,通过A/B测试验证:
- 模型准确率差异
- 用户操作路径变化
- 系统资源消耗模式
3.2 用户培训体系
开发交互式教程平台,集成:
- 沙箱环境(预置测试数据)
- 操作录像回放功能
- 实时错误诊断
关键代码片段:
// 教程系统核心逻辑
function executeUserCode(code) {
try {
const result = eval(code); // 实际环境需用安全沙箱
updateTutorialState('SUCCESS');
} catch (e) {
logErrorPattern(e.message);
provideHint(e);
}
}
四、安全合规实践:数据治理与权限控制
4.1 零信任架构实施
构建包含以下要素的访问控制体系:
- 多因素认证(MFA)
- 基于属性的访问控制(ABAC)
- 动态会话令牌
关键配置示例:
# abac_policy.yaml
match:
- type: user
attributes:
department: ["engineering", "research"]
- type: resource
attributes:
sensitivity: ["medium", "high"]
effect: allow
4.2 数据生命周期管理
实现自动化的数据分类与处理流程:
# data_classifier.py
def classify_data(text):
if contains_pii(text):
return "HIGH_SENSITIVITY", anonymize(text)
elif is_business_critical(text):
return "MEDIUM_SENSITIVITY", redact(text)
else:
return "LOW_SENSITIVITY", text
五、成本优化方案:资源利用最大化
5.1 混合云部署策略
采用”本地GPU集群+云弹性资源”的混合架构:
- 核心模型训练:本地NVIDIA A100集群
- 峰值流量处理:云上T4实例自动伸缩
- 冷数据存储:对象存储服务
5.2 模型量化技术
应用FP16量化将模型体积压缩60%,推理速度提升2.3倍:
# quantization.py
import torch
model = torch.load('original_model.pt')
quantized_model = torch.quantization.quantize_dynamic(
model, {torch.nn.Linear}, dtype=torch.qint8
)
torch.save(quantized_model.state_dict(), 'quantized_model.pt')
六、实施效果与经验总结
6.1 关键指标对比
指标 | 传统方案 | AOne方案 | 提升幅度 |
---|---|---|---|
部署周期 | 30天 | 22小时 | 97.6% |
运维成本 | $12,000/月 | $3,200/月 | 73.3% |
用户采纳率 | 68% | 92% | 35.3% |
6.2 可复制的方法论
- 架构预研:提前完成技术栈选型与POC验证
- 工具沉淀:构建可复用的自动化脚本库
- 风险管控:建立分级响应机制(P0-P3)
- 反馈闭环:搭建用户行为分析看板
结语:AI工程化的新范式
AOne的实践表明,通过模块化设计、自动化工具链和渐进式推广策略的有机结合,企业级AI部署完全可以突破传统时间边界。这种”快速迭代、安全可控”的工程化方法,为AI技术在企业场景的规模化应用提供了可复制的范本。随着模型压缩、边缘计算等技术的成熟,未来AI部署效率还将持续提升,但工程化思维始终是连接技术潜力与业务价值的关键桥梁。
发表评论
登录后可评论,请前往 登录 或 注册